What It Does

Bricks MCP is a WordPress plugin that implements an MCP (Model Context Protocol) server, letting AI assistants read and write your Bricks Builder site. Connect Claude, Gemini, or any MCP-compatible client and manage pages, templates, global classes, theme styles, WooCommerce layouts, and more — all through natural language.

Features

  • 20+ MCP tools covering the full Bricks Builder data model

  • Read and write pages, templates, elements, and global settings

  • WooCommerce support (product pages, cart, checkout, account templates)

  • Global classes, theme styles, typography scales, color palettes, variables

  • Media library management with Unsplash integration

  • WordPress menus, fonts, and custom code management

  • Built-in connection tester and config snippet generator

  • Works with Claude Code, Claude Desktop, Gemini, and any MCP client

Requirements

  • WordPress 6.4+

  • PHP 8.2+

  • Bricks Builder 1.6+

Installation

  1. Download the latest release from GitHub Releases

  2. Upload to your WordPress site via Plugins > Add New > Upload Plugin

  3. Activate the plugin

  4. Go to Settings > Bricks MCP to configure

Connecting Your AI Tool

Claude Code

claude mcp add --transport http bricks-mcp https://yoursite.com/wp-json/bricks-mcp/v1/mcp

Claude Desktop / Other MCP Clients

Add to your MCP config (.mcp.json or equivalent):

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"bricks-mcp": {
      "type": "http",
      "url": "https://yoursite.com/wp-json/bricks-mcp/v1/mcp",
      "headers": {
        "Authorization": "Basic BASE64_ENCODED_CREDENTIALS"
      }
    }
  }
}

Authentication uses WordPress Application Passwords (Users > Profile > Application Passwords).

Available Tools

Tool

Description

get_site_info

WordPress site information and configuration

wordpress

Manage posts, pages, users, plugins, comments, taxonomies

get_builder_guide

Bricks Builder documentation for AI context

bricks

Read/write Bricks settings, query loops, interactions

page

Create, read, update, delete Bricks pages and elements

element

Fine-grained element operations (add, move, style, clone)

template

Manage Bricks templates (header, footer, section, etc.)

template_condition

Set display conditions on templates

template_taxonomy

Manage template taxonomy terms

global_class

Create and manage global CSS classes

theme_style

Create and manage theme styles

typography_scale

Typography scale presets

color_palette

Color palette management

global_variable

Global CSS variables

media

Upload media, search Unsplash, manage library

menu

WordPress menu management

component

Bricks component (reusable element) management

woocommerce

WooCommerce page templates and product layouts

font

Custom font management

code

Page-level CSS and JavaScript

Configuration

Go to Settings > Bricks MCP in WordPress admin:

  • Enable MCP Server — toggle the server on/off

  • Require Authentication — restrict access to authenticated users

  • Custom Base URL — for reverse proxies or custom domains

  • Dangerous Actions — enable write access to global Bricks settings and code execution

Extending

Add custom tools using the bricks_mcp_tools filter:

add_filter( 'bricks_mcp_tools', function( $tools ) {
    $tools['my_custom_tool'] = [
        'name'        => 'my_custom_tool',
        'description' => 'My custom tool description',
        'inputSchema' => [
            'type'       => 'object',
            'properties' => [],
        ],
        'handler'     => function( $args ) {
            return ['result' => 'success'];
        },
    ];
    return $tools;
});

Local Development

npm install
npm run start        # Start WordPress (Docker via wp-env)
npm run test         # Run PHPUnit tests
npm run lint         # WordPress coding standards check
npm run lint:fix     # Auto-fix linting issues

Local site: http://localhost:8888 (admin / password)
